How they compare

Peru currently reports 81,707 t against 52,019 t in Sri Lanka, a difference of 29,688 t.

That makes Peru's figure about 1.6 times Sri Lanka's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 18 shared years of data; in 2007 it was Sri Lanka ahead.

Peru ranks 9th and Sri Lanka ranks 11th of 45 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Peru averaged higher in 1 and Sri Lanka in 2.

Crop and livestock statistics are recorded for 278 products, covering the following categories: 1) CROPS PRIMARY: Cereals, Citrus Fruit, Fibre Crops, Fruit, Oil Crops, Oil Crops and Cakes in Oil Equivalent, Pulses, Roots and Tubers, Sugar Crops, Treenuts and Vegetables. Data are expressed in terms of area harvested, production quantity and yield. Cereals: Area and production data on cereals relate to crops harvested for dry grain only.
